Project for Biological CO2 Fixation and Utilization

     

     

  1. Objectives
  2.  This project is aimed to develop technologies to fix CO2 in the flue gas from the generation sources such as power plants and factories, with more of ten times higher efficiency than natural vegetation does, and to produce the useful substances from the fixed CO2.  

     

  3. Duration
  4. 1990-1999

  7. R & D Subject
    1. The search are being executed for the photosynthetic microorganisms capable of fixing CO2 at higher rate and of producing useful substances under the severe condition of temperature 30 - 40℃ and CO2 concentration 10% in the area of the inland water field such as lake/marsh, river, hot-spring etc and ocean field including the coral reef. Breeding of the photosynthetic microorganisms by employing the molecular bio-technology are also being studied. The study of optimized culture conditions for these microorganisms on CO2 fixation are also being carried out.

    2. R & D of photosynthesizing culture system are being performed for high-density and large-volume CO2 fixation to maximize the photosynthetic capability. The study are being executed for the technology of the highly concentrated sunlight collection & transmission system into the photo-bioreactor system, the technology to separate & use the infrared sunlight, and the technology to control sophisticatedly the culture condition in the reactors to allow the microorganisms to photosynthesize at the highest efficiency under the collected & transmitted sunlight. The technologies are also studied to convert the photosynthetic product into the energy substances such as hydrocarbon, lipid etc and to useful substances such as manure, feed, amino acid and polysaccharide. Improvement of the whole the systemization above of CO2 fixation and utilization system is being studied.
